I managed to kill all the fish in my tank except the loaches with an overdose of CO2, and the loaches (7 of them), which had been very outgoing before, went into hiding. They never came out when I was around, even to eat. When I replaced the other fish a few weeks later, the loaches came out again and were just as gregarious as ever.

I hadn't realized until then that they really did need dither fish. They get on extremely well with my SAE's and discus. They were a bit too boistrous for the corys, and the corys are doing much better in a tank with no competition from other bottom feeders.
